Boulder Brighton Inter Schools Competition 2024
We are delighted to be able to run an inter schools competition again this year. The qualifying round of the competition will run throughout the week starting 22nd January. This is a competition for secondary age pupils from years 7 to 13 and most appropriate from age 13 up as the blocs will be set with teenage climbers in mind.
Schools enter a team of 8 to 30 climbers with an ideal team being a team of 10 climbers. Each team must be from within one of the age categories – U16 or 16+ They book in for a climbing session at Boulder Brighton and have up to 2 hours to attempt the 25 competition blocs (for schools who come regularly this can be during the usual sessions booked by the schools). 2 hours is the maximum period allowed, if schools can only manage a session of 1 or 1.5hrs it will still be possible to enter the competition.
The competition will be a set of 25 blocs with 7 points for the bonus, 10 points for the top and an extra 2 points if it is topped first time (the flash). Schools will be ranked by the highest total score from any 8 of their entrants. There will be U16 and 16+ categories (age as of 1st September 2023). We will also have first, second and third place individual male, female and all gender results from the qualifiers.
It is £7 entry per person (includes climbing shoe hire). We will provide an instructor to supervise the competition climbing for up to 10 participants, any more than this will require an additional instructor at an extra £40 for each additional 10 participants.
Pre-booking is essential. We are running sessions every day at 09:30, 11:45, 14:00 and 15:30 with a maximum of two schools at any one session. If your school has a regular session at Boulder Brighton the competition can be completed during that session. The sessions will book up so please book in early.
The top 5 schools in each category (U16 and 16+) will qualify for a grand final taking place on Thursday 22nd February. U16 finals starting at 2pm, 16+ finals starting at 3pm. Schools should bring a team of 3 to the finals (and any supporters) and they will climb as a team under timed, judged conditions.
